Okay. Well, there are three things that I am aware of as
far as issues that they’ve had recently. And when I say recently, I’m talking
about in the last two or three months. So two times that they have had issues
with their platform have stopped. No has stopped working completely where
people have not been able to trade buy or sell anything on their platform for a
period of time. So with all the craziness that’s been going on lately with the
stock market, there have been several days where people have not been able to
sell any of their companies or by any of their companies because they have lost
the ability to them to do anything on their platform. So that in itself is a
